10/10 Reed Richards Should Definitely Be Able To Shapeshift

Reed Richards from Marvel Comics' Fantastic Four stares off into space

Iron Man isn’t the smartest Marvel hero. In many ways, Reed Richards is Tony’s intellectual superior. Reed’s a polymath scientist, with mastery in nearly every science. His superpowers are none too shabby, making him pliable and stretchy. However, Richards should be able to do much more with them.

In one future, Reed stretched his brain and made himself telepathic, but that’s just the beginning. When considering how his powers work, Richards should be able to shapeshift. While he can’t change the color of his hair and skin, he should be able to shape his features into anyone else’s. However, Reed devotes himself to science instead of mastering his powers.

9/10 Sunfire Could Possibly Control The Sun Itself

An image of Sunfire showing off his flame abilities

Sunfire is a C-list member of the X-Men. He’s had several short stints with the team, acted as a Horseman of Apocalypse for a time, and basically comported himself somewhat pompously. However, his arrogance is warranted when looking at his powers.

Sunfire absorbs solar energy and can create plasma, the same super-heated matter that comprises the sun, and controls it mentally. Sunfire’s ability to control plasma could apply to the sun itself, considering it’s a giant ball of plasma. If he trained at it, there’s a chance Sunfire could wield the sun itself as a weapon.

8/10 Jubilee’s Powers Are Way More Formidable Than They Seem

Jubilee unleashes her fireworks in Marvel Comics - X-Men

Jubilee gets a bad rap when it comes to her powers. Everyone thinks of her as the firework girl, but they forget that fireworks hurt a lot when they hit people. Jubilee has spent years working with her powers, allowing her to fire off more powerful bursts.

Jubilee’s powers are based on plasma that she can produce. This means that her main power isn’t making cool fireworks, but super-heating matter until it reaches the plasma state. That’s an amazing and dangerous power, one that’s reminiscent of Gambit’s power in a lot of ways, except Jubilee’s is much more dangerous.

7/10 Invisible Woman Is Immensely Powerful

Marvel Comics' Invisible Woman deflecting attacks

Invisible Woman is the most powerful member of the Fantastic Four, and turning invisible is just the beginning of what she can do. By manipulating invisible energy, she can create force fields, constructs, and concussive bursts. This energy comes from Hyperspace, meaning that Invisible Woman can manipulate energy from another plane of existence.

If Invisible Woman can do it to one plane, it’s reasonable to believe she could do the same to another. Additionally, she does it all psionically. This is a lot like telekinesis, except for energy instead of solid matter. If she worked on it, Invisible Woman could almost certainly use her power to manipulate other energy fields around her, since her mind is accustomed to manipulating energy.

6/10 Jean Grey Can Control Molecules

Hellfire Gala Jean Grey in dress and diadem

The Omega class mutants of the X-Men are quite powerful, with Jean Grey near the top of the hierarchy. Jean is a telepath of the highest order, second only to Charles Xavier in power and skill. She’s also an amazing telekinetic, allowing her to fly, create force fields, and move things with her mind. Jean can also fire powerful concussive bursts.

Telekinesis is amazing, and Jean’s definitely lives up to that. In fact, with enough concentration, Jean could manipulate matter. If she tried hard enough, Jean could use her powers to move molecules, taking things apart and rearranging them on a molecular level.

5/10 Scarlet Witch Is Basically A God

Hellfire Gala Scarlet Witch with headdress in Marvel Comics

Scarlet Witch can beat Marvel’s cosmic beings if it came right down to it. Her reality altering power is an amazing ability, and she’s done some jaw-dropping things with it. Creating the House Of M reality is quite impressive, but she recently used her magic and reality altering power in tangent to create what amounts to an afterlife for mutants. This allows mutants to be resurrected even if they died before Xavier started using Cerebro to back up mutant minds.

This puts Scarlet Witch at a new level. If she can do that, there’s basically no limit to her power aside from her imagination. It’s actually probably a good thing that Scarlet Witch doesn’t realize that, since she has a reputation for breaking down under the strain of her vast and raw power.

4/10 Storm Can Manipulate Electromagnetic Energy

An image of Storm with the Fantastic Four

Marvel keeps letting Storm get better, something that extended to her powers as well. Storm’s weather control is a great ability, but the power behind it is even greater. Storm can control electromagnetic energy currents, which in turn manipulates the weather. Electromagnetism is a fundamental force in the universe.

Storm helped keep Magneto alive when he went after Uranos for revenge by fueling him with electromagnetic power. So, while Storm being able to control the weather is great, she could be even more powerful if she learned to harness electromagnetic energy in new ways.

3/10 The Hulk Can Control Gamma Radiation

An image of the Hulk wearing royal accessories and a crown in Marvel Comics

The Hulk is the strongest one there is, and that’s usually enough for any fight. He has infinite strength potential, amazing durability, and a healing factor. Hulk’s power comes from gamma radiation, and he’s basically a gamma energy battery. The more angry he gets, he not only increases his strength but also his output of gamma energy.

The Hulk has displayed an ability to control gamma energy in the past. The Hulk isn’t really the type of person to hone other abilities, but if he put in the work with his gamma energy manipulating powers, he could definitely become unstoppable.

2/10 Silver Surfer Can Control Matter Completely

Marvel Comics' Silver Surfer flying forward yelling

Marvel’s cosmic heroes are quite formidable, but Silver Surfer is easily the most powerful. Fueled by the Power Cosmic, Silver Surfer is strong, durable, and fast, able to travel space very quickly, moving many times the speed of light. He can manipulate cosmic energy at a very high level, but the greatest ability the Power Cosmic gives Silver Surfer is also his least used.

The Power Cosmic allows Silver Surfer to manipulate matter. He can make matter change states, but he can also transform one thing into another. That’s an amazing power, and it gives Silver Surfer an unprecedented amount of control over matter.

1/10 The Sentry Used The Barest Minimum Of His Powers

Marvel Comics' Sentry in space above Earth

There are some scary Avengers out there, but few can match the Sentry. One reason for this is the Void, Sentry’s dark side, that can take control of him at any time. The second reason is his power. It’s said that Sentry has the power of a million exploding suns. This mostly comes out in his strength, durability, flight, and energy powers, but he and the Void have used other abilities.

The Sentry and Void have psionic powers, matter manipulating powers, and low grade reality altering powers. The Void sometimes taps into these powers at a low level, but that’s all. The Sentry is much more powerful than even he knows, which is both impressive and frightening to think about.
